Shared Health leads the planning and coordinates the integration of patient-centred clinical and preventive health services across Manitoba. The organization also delivers some province-wide health services and supports centralized administrative and business functions for Manitoba health organizations.

Position Overview

Digital Health focuses on supporting clinical and business systems as the foundation for leveraging electronic data in the delivery of health-care services.

We have an application support technician (AST) position available. AST positions may be assigned across Digital Health. However, we are currently seeking applicants in Clinical Digital Solutions which supports the introduction, use, optimization, integration and sustainment of effective clinical informatics and digital health processes, systems, services, and technologies. Reporting to a supervisor, the AST will:

  • Maintain secure access to assigned applications
  • Provide second level (Tier 2) application support for assigned technologies
  • Maintain procedure guides and forms
Experience
  • 2 years of experience working in an office environment providing customer service support in-person and by telephone with advanced use of office productivity tools (such as the Microsoft Office Suite and Adobe Acrobat Pro) including maintenance of spreadsheet and database content to respond to changing priorities, meet tight deadlines and high customer expectations
  • Experience providing support for clinical application(s), providing application accounts, using SQL commands and formal call tracking/work order management software (such as Remedy), testing, training, and maintaining documentation for software applications, and working in health informatics are assets
Education (Degree/Diploma/Certificate)
  • Post-secondary diploma in a computer science, information technology or health informatics related program from an accredited postsecondary educational institution
  • Successful completion of a recognized customer service course is an asset
  • Working knowledge of and practical experience applying Manitoba\'s Personal Health Information Act (PHIA) is preferred
An equivalent combination of relevant training and experience may be considered.
